Note "This conference on Geometry of Riemann Surfaces and related topics was held in ... Anogia at the Conference Centre of the University of Crete, spanning four days in June and July 2007"--Page vii.
Summary Riemann surfaces is a thriving area of mathematics with applications to hyperbolic geometry, complex analysis, conformal dynamics, discrete groups, & algebraic curves. This collection of articles presents original research & expert surveys of related topics, making the field accessible to research workers, graduate students & teachers.
